Output 5a50072ced7b777cd52ab73f0fb22b119db44e1fd6aa32e04b7814eb753fcd7f:18

value
1043944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b2d266153f0f13753e8e8c381dae2b5b25d701 OP_EQUAL
address
3B434sX3Tw7wCTYEsLym5A6yL5XCAe7q5D
transaction
5a50072ced7b777cd52ab73f0fb22b119db44e1fd6aa32e04b7814eb753fcd7f
spent
true